Palmer warning drivers to be 'ultra-fit' for Melbourne
XPB Images
Jolyon Palmer is warning that any driver lacking an optimal level of fitness at the start of the season will be 'found out' by the big physical demands of F1's 2017 cars. The regulation changes ushered in this season will thoroughly put the emphasis on downforce and increased cornering speeds, and they will take their toll on anyone who starts the year unprepared, says the Renault driver. "I can see it making a difference," Palmer said. "We don't really know exactly the performance: we know the numbers, but we don't know what the tyres are going to do.
